Utopia lies at the horizon. When I draw nearer by two steps, it retreats two steps. If I proceed ten steps forward, it swiftly slips ten steps ahead.

No matter how far I go, I can never reach it. What, then, is the purpose of utopia? It is to cause us to advance.

Eduardi Gughes Galeano
